Why STEM Works Here So Well

The Cologne City Library describes STEM as creative, exciting, and an invitation to research, discover, comprehend, and wonder. The storytime sessions are aimed at children aged 4 and above and conclude with a small experiment. The program is supported by volunteer storytelling partners and in cooperation with the Stiftung Lesen, the Deutsche Telekom Stiftung, and the NRW Youth Media Culture Authority. The Venue: Haus Balchem in the Severinsviertel

The district library Haus Balchem is located at Severinstraße 15 in Cologne's Altstadt/Süd. According to the city of Cologne, the historic building is only very limited accessible for wheelchair users. The library is easily reachable by tram and bus via the Severinstraße and Chlodwigplatz stops. The city library also points out that most offerings can be used without a library card and the card is free until the age of 20.
